Lending spreads

The spread between average mortgage rates and the repo rate has fallen over the last 6 months or so. The spread between average lending rates and average mortgage rates has also narrowed. We argued in this paper that the rise in the spread between mortgage rates and the policy rate since the global financial crisis partly reflected a rise in bank funding costs and in this paper that mortgage rates fully reflected changes in the policy rate if one controls for funding costs and offsetting changes in risk and liquidity premia.
